    The other way to look at this is, should the rumour be believed, we are in the same market as the European elite. Therefore, the clubs ambition is right at the top.

    I think we and Villa are in the difficult position of trying to break into the CL places consistently. Both teams need to be there year on year to grow global fanbases and revenues to attract the top players. If we get one wrong the drop off in quality could tank a season, and we don't have the revenues of the "big 6" to buy loads, to cover up mistakes,

    Brighton, Fulham etc are, currently, trying to get into Europe, so the drop off for a missed transfer is no where near as big as it is for us. They can then take the risk on the little known player from Ukraine knowing that if bad, it won't be terrible, if good then they possibly get Europe, if they are great then the above applies and a European giant may come in and give them a bumper pay day.

    Let's face it, we would all have been happy with Khusanov which i think would have counted as a good bit of scouting before Man City sniped the deal...
